Default New with Nerve block side effects

I'm new to the site, and I'm trying to find some info about nerve block side effects. I had knee surgery in mid March, for which I had a femeral nerve block, only problem is, not all of my leg "woke up". I have a section of my lower leg and across the top of my foot which are completely numb still today. I also have lost some function in my ankle and foot. Basically I can't turn my foot outward or pull my toes upward..."footdrop" as it's been explained to me. I have had 2 EMG tests, one at 3 weeks and one at 6 weeks post op. At 3 weeks the area showed zero electical response to the shock portion of the test. However at 6 weeks, it did show "some" response. Apparently it should show as a bell curve (normal), but mine wasn't normal, and wasn't as fast as the normal response for a person my age. On the other hand, it was an improvement over the initial test 3 weeks earlier, on which I have hung my hopes for nerve recovery. This week I'll be 12 weeks post op, and I haven't seen any imporvement that I can tell myself, and I'm wondering if anyone can add any insight to my ordeal. What can I do, or not do, that will help with recovery or at least give it it's best opportunity to come back. Thanks in advance.
